Why Dry Mouth Causes Severely Cracked Lips

Dry mouth, or xerostomia, happens when your salivary glands don’t produce enough saliva to keep your mouth moist. While we often blame cold weather for chapped lips, a lack of saliva creates a chronic internal drought that is far more damaging. Saliva is a natural protectant; it neutralizes acids, helps wash away food particles, and contains enzymes that begin digestion while also protecting oral tissues.

Without this constant, gentle rinsing and moisturizing, the delicate skin on your lips becomes incredibly vulnerable. It loses its primary source of hydration from the inside out, leading to rapid moisture loss to the external environment. This dehydration results in the tell-tale signs of severe chapping: deep cracks, flaking, inflammation, and sometimes even painful bleeding at the corners of the mouth.

Many common medications prescribed for adults can list dry mouth as a side effect, making this an issue that requires a proactive management plan. Simply applying a waxy, flavored balm won’t solve the underlying problem. You need a product that can mimic saliva’s protective qualities by both hydrating the tissue and creating a durable barrier against further moisture loss.

Aquaphor Lip Repair for Deeply Chapped Skin

For lips that have moved past simple dryness into a state of deep chapping and cracking, a more intensive solution is required. Aquaphor Lip Repair is a dermatologist-recommended staple for a reason: it’s a powerhouse for healing compromised skin. Its thick, ointment-like consistency provides immediate relief and a formidable barrier against the elements.

The formula is built around key ingredients known for their restorative properties. Panthenol (a form of Vitamin B5) and shea butter work to moisturize and condition, while chamomile essence soothes irritation. The petrolatum base acts as an occlusive, meaning it creates a seal that locks in moisture and protects the vulnerable skin underneath, giving it the protected environment it needs to heal.

This is the product you turn to for urgent care. It’s not a light, glossy balm; it’s a functional, fragrance-free healing ointment. Think of it as a first-aid essential for your lips, providing the heavy-duty support needed to repair significant damage and restore comfort quickly.

La Roche-Posay Cicaplast for Lip Barrier Repair

Sometimes, the goal is not just to cover the problem but to help the skin rebuild its own defenses. La Roche-Posay’s Cicaplast Lips is formulated around the concept of barrier repair. It uses a unique combination of ingredients to soothe immediate discomfort while supporting the skin’s natural healing process for more resilient lips over time.

The key ingredients tell the story. Panthenol is included at a high concentration (5%) to intensely soothe, while MP-Lipids help to rebuild the skin’s protective barrier layer by layer. This combination doesn’t just put a temporary patch on the problem; it provides the building blocks the skin needs to repair itself from within.

This product is an excellent choice for those experiencing recurring or chronic chapped lips due to dry mouth. It represents a more sophisticated, long-term strategy. It helps break the cycle of cracking and peeling by strengthening the lip barrier, making it less vulnerable to dehydration in the future.

CeraVe Healing Ointment with Added Ceramides

For a science-backed approach that combines protection with active skin barrier support, CeraVe Healing Ointment is a top contender. While not exclusively a lip balm, its gentle, effective formula is perfectly suited for the task. The standout feature of CeraVe products is the inclusion of ceramides.

Ceramides are lipids (fats) that are naturally found in the skin and are essential for maintaining its barrier and retaining moisture. When lips are chapped, this barrier is compromised, and ceramide levels are depleted. This ointment replenishes those crucial components, helping to restore the barrier’s function while hyaluronic acid attracts and retains hydration.

Like Aquaphor, it has a petrolatum base that creates a protective seal, but the addition of ceramides and hyaluronic acid gives it a dual-action role of both protecting and actively restoring. It’s an ideal multi-purpose product to have on hand, serving as an intensive overnight lip mask or a spot treatment for any severely dry skin.

Vaseline Lip Therapy: A Simple Protective Seal

In a world of complex formulas, there is still a place for simple, proven effectiveness. Vaseline, made from 100% pure petrolatum, is the ultimate occlusive. It doesn’t contain active moisturizers or hydrators; its sole job is to create an impenetrable barrier that stops "transepidermal water loss" in its tracks.

This simplicity is its power. By applying a thin layer of Vaseline to damp lips, you can effectively trap existing moisture and give the skin underneath a completely protected environment to heal. It prevents wind, dry air, and other environmental factors from drawing precious hydration out of your lips.

Vaseline is an incredibly cost-effective and reliable tool. It’s the perfect final step in a routine—apply it over a more hydrating serum or after wetting your lips to lock everything in. For anyone who prefers a no-nonsense, single-ingredient solution, this classic remains one of the best protective options available.

Daily Habits for Long-Term Lip Health

The right lip balm is a critical tool, but it works best as part of a broader strategy for managing dry mouth and its effects. Lasting comfort comes from building small, consistent habits into your daily life. These actions support your body’s hydration from the inside out, reducing your reliance on topical products alone.

Start by assessing your hydration. Sipping water consistently throughout the day is more effective than drinking large amounts at once. At night, consider placing a humidifier in your bedroom; this adds moisture to the air, preventing it from pulling hydration from your skin and lips while you sleep. This simple environmental modification can make a significant difference by morning.

Pay attention to your behaviors. Unconsciously licking dry lips provides a moment of relief but is ultimately counterproductive, as the saliva evaporates quickly and takes more moisture with it. Finally, if dry mouth is a persistent issue, have a conversation with your doctor or dentist. They can help review your medications and overall health to identify the root cause, which is the most powerful step toward a long-term solution.
